Document Description
Caltrans proposes to construct the State Route 120 Oakdale Expressway Project, a two-lane expressway with interchanges, to bypass the CIty of Oakdale in Stanislaus County. Caltrans will also acquire right-of-way to meet future transportation needs. The purpose of the project is to reduce the congestion on State Route 120, improve safety by reducing the number of accidents, and improve system continuity.
